Red de conocimientos turísticos - Conocimientos sobre calendario chino - Tecnología y aplicaciones de computación en la nube

Tecnología y aplicaciones de computación en la nube

La computación en la nube se basa principalmente en las dos tecnologías centrales de virtualización de recursos y arquitectura paralela distribuida, y existe una gran cantidad de software de código abierto en Internet para brindar soporte a los usuarios, como Xen, KVM, Lighttpd, Memcached, Nginx, Hadoop, Eucalytus esperan. La tecnología de computación en la nube ahorra efectivamente la inversión en hardware, los costos de desarrollo de software y los costos de mantenimiento de los proveedores de servicios en la nube.

1. Arquitectura paralela distribuida

La arquitectura paralela distribuida es otra tecnología central de la computación en la nube. Se utiliza para integrar una gran cantidad de máquinas en una supercomputadora para proporcionar almacenamiento y procesamiento masivo de datos. servicios. La supercomputadora integrada proporciona almacenamiento masivo de archivos y almacenamiento masivo de datos estructurados, y proporciona un método de programación unificado y un entorno operativo para el procesamiento masivo de datos a través de sistemas de archivos distribuidos, bases de datos distribuidas y tecnología MapReduce

2 Tecnología de virtualización virtual

La tecnología de virtualización se divide principalmente en dos niveles: grupo de recursos físicos y gestión del grupo de recursos. Entre ellos, la agrupación de recursos físicos consiste en hacer que los dispositivos físicos sean más pequeños y más grandes, y virtualizar un dispositivo físico en múltiples unidades de recursos mínimos con un rendimiento controlable. La administración del grupo de recursos consiste en administrar las unidades mínimas de recursos virtualizados en el clúster, según los requisitos del usuario. El uso y la aplicación de recursos se pueden asignar y programar de manera flexible de acuerdo con ciertas estrategias para lograr la asignación de recursos bajo demanda.

Las principales aplicaciones de la computación en la nube son:

El almacenamiento en la nube almacena datos masivos del usuario en la nube, lo que le permite acceder a sus datos e información en cualquier momento y lugar.

Los juegos en la nube colocan la ejecución y el almacenamiento de los juegos en la nube y solicitan un espacio de hardware y software específico según el tamaño del juego, lo que puede ampliar de manera flexible el alcance del servicio y la potencia informática del juego.

La seguridad en la nube registra el estado de seguridad de cada terminal a través de la nube, obteniendo así una base de datos de aplicaciones de seguridad muy grande, de modo que pueda responder bien a diversos ataques y vulnerabilidades.

La educación en la nube coloca varios servicios educativos en la plataforma en la nube para ampliar el alcance y el contenido de los servicios.

Básicamente, las aplicaciones de computación en la nube son servicios basados ​​en red. Colocan en la red muchos servicios que solo se pueden completar localmente y utilizan las poderosas funciones del sistema de computación en la nube para expandir los servicios y aplicaciones.

/javascript" src="../css/tongji.js">